OpenGrok
Home
Sort by:
relevance
|
last modified time
|
path
Full Search
in project(s):
src
xsrc
Definition
Symbol
File Path
History
|
|
Help
Searched
defs:MaskTy
(Results
1 - 9
of
9
) sorted by relevancy
/src/external/apache2/llvm/dist/llvm/lib/Target/X86/
X86ShuffleDecodeConstantPool.cpp
191
Type *
MaskTy
= C->getType();
192
unsigned MaskTySize =
MaskTy
->getPrimitiveSizeInBits();
246
Type *
MaskTy
= C->getType();
247
unsigned MaskTySize =
MaskTy
->getPrimitiveSizeInBits();
X86InstCombineIntrinsic.cpp
1263
auto *
MaskTy
= FixedVectorType::get(
1266
Mask = IC.Builder.CreateBitCast(Mask,
MaskTy
);
X86TargetTransformInfo.cpp
3449
auto *
MaskTy
=
3457
getScalarizationOverhead(
MaskTy
, DemandedElts, false, true);
3479
getShuffleCost(TTI::SK_PermuteTwoSrc,
MaskTy
, None, 0, nullptr);
3482
auto *NewMaskTy = FixedVectorType::get(
MaskTy
->getElementType(),
3485
Cost += getShuffleCost(TTI::SK_InsertSubvector, NewMaskTy, None, 0,
MaskTy
);
4382
auto *
MaskTy
=
4385
getScalarizationOverhead(
MaskTy
, DemandedElts, false, true);
/src/external/apache2/llvm/dist/llvm/lib/CodeGen/GlobalISel/
MachineIRBuilder.cpp
212
LLT
MaskTy
= LLT::scalar(PtrTy.getSizeInBits());
213
Register MaskReg = getMRI()->createGenericVirtualRegister(
MaskTy
);
IRTranslator.cpp
1004
LLT
MaskTy
= SwitchOpTy;
1009
MaskTy
= LLT::scalar(64);
1014
if (SwitchOpTy !=
MaskTy
)
1015
SubReg = MIB.buildZExtOrTrunc(
MaskTy
, SubReg).getReg(0);
1017
B.RegVT = getMVTForLLT(
MaskTy
);
/src/external/apache2/llvm/dist/llvm/lib/Target/Hexagon/
HexagonVectorCombine.cpp
1170
auto *
MaskTy
= cast<VectorType>(Mask->getType());
1171
int FromCount =
MaskTy
->getElementCount().getFixedValue();
/src/external/apache2/llvm/dist/llvm/lib/CodeGen/
MachineVerifier.cpp
1136
LLT
MaskTy
= MRI->getType(MI->getOperand(2).getReg());
1137
if (!DstTy.isValid() || !SrcTy.isValid() || !
MaskTy
.isValid())
1143
if (!
MaskTy
.getScalarType().isScalar())
1146
verifyVectorElementMatch(DstTy,
MaskTy
, MI);
/src/external/apache2/llvm/dist/llvm/lib/IR/
AutoUpgrade.cpp
1109
llvm::VectorType *
MaskTy
= FixedVectorType::get(
1111
Mask = Builder.CreateBitCast(Mask,
MaskTy
);
1145
auto *
MaskTy
= FixedVectorType::get(Builder.getInt1Ty(),
1147
Mask = Builder.CreateBitCast(Mask,
MaskTy
);
2511
Type *
MaskTy
= VectorType::get(Type::getInt32Ty(C), EC);
2513
ShuffleVectorInst::getShuffleMask(Constant::getNullValue(
MaskTy
), M);
/src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
AMDGPUInstructionSelector.cpp
2490
LLT
MaskTy
= MRI->getType(MaskReg);
2508
TRI.getRegClassForTypeOnBank(
MaskTy
, *MaskRB, *MRI);
2518
assert(
MaskTy
.getSizeInBits() == 32 &&
Completed in 41 milliseconds
Indexes created Sun Jun 21 00:25:28 UTC 2026